Help with correct sim settings
Guys,
I want to start a historical league using the 1985 Oakland A's I then want to switch to the Florida Marlins in 2002. This is the way my baseball history went so I want to follow that. I have lots of questions though I want to play every game game by game. I want players to go to their original teams I want them to retire when they decide not like in real life I want the league to auto expand Now here are my questions When I did this to start it made me have a rookie draft half way through the first season. Since I want rookies going to their correct teams, I want this turned off right? I wish I could have a farm league to develop players, but I hate have a minor league team with 4 players and the rest ghost players. I also dont want fictional players. So I guys I should go with the reserve roster? What happens when the league expands, how does the league make sure the new teams get the same players they got during that draft? Any other thoghts or suggestions. I also remember a utility where it would change your logos based on the year of your league, is that still around? |

As for other thoughts, unless you completely disable injuries and do not allow trading, players will have different career spans and team histories. And if you do not allow trading then that does not reflect history accurately unless you manually force the trades that happened IRL. One last thing is that your financial settings like free agency and arbitration periods will also have an effect on the movement of players. |
